3 <br />1.7 “Channel” means a portion of the electromagnetic frequency spectrum which is used in a <br />Cable System and which is capable of delivering a television channel as defined by the FCC by <br />regulation, as set forth in Applicable Law, currently 47 U.S.C. § 522(4). <br /> <br />1.8 “City” means the City of Lake Elmo, a municipal corporation in the State of Minnesota, <br />acting by and through its City Council, or its lawfully appointed designee. <br /> <br />1.9 “City Code” means the Municipal Code of the City of Lake Elmo, Minnesota, as <br />may be amended from time to time. <br /> <br />1.10 “Commission” means the Ramsey Washington Counties Suburban Cable Communications <br />Commission II or its successors, delegations, or its lawfully appointed designee, including <br />representatives of the Member Cities as may exist pursuant to a then valid and existing Joint and <br />Cooperative Agreement among Member Cities. <br /> <br />1.11 “Converter” means an electronic device, including Digital Transport Adapters, which <br />converts signals to a frequency not susceptible to interference within the television receiver of a <br />Subscriber, and by an appropriate Channel selector also permits a Subscriber to view all Cable <br />Service signals. <br /> <br />1.12 “City Council” means the governing body of the City of Lake Elmo, Minnesota. <br /> <br />1.13 “Day” means a calendar day, unless otherwise specified. <br /> <br />1.14 “Drop” means the cable that connects the Subscriber terminal to the nearest feeder cable <br />of the cable in the Street and any electronics on subscriber property between the Street and the <br />Subscriber terminal. <br /> <br />1.15 “Effective Date” means April 1, 2021. <br /> <br />1.16 “FCC” means the Federal Communications Commission and any legally appointed, <br />designated or elected agent or successor. <br /> <br />1.17 “Franchise” means the right granted by this Franchise Ordinance and the regulatory and <br />contractual relationship established hereby. <br /> <br />1.18 “Franchise Area” means the entire geographic area within the City as it is now constituted <br />or may in the future be constituted. <br /> <br />1.19 “Franchise Fee” means the fee assessed by the City to Grantee, in consideration of <br />Grantee’s right to operate the Cable System within the City’s Streets, determined in amount as a <br />percentage of Grantee’s Gross Revenues and limited to the maximum percentage allowed for such <br />assessment by federal law. The term Franchise Fee does not include the exceptions noted in 47 <br />U.S.C. §542(g)(2)(A-E). <br /> <br />1.20 “GAAP” means generally accepted accounting principles as promulgated and defined by <br />the Financial Accounting Standards Board (“FASB”), Emerging Issues Task Force (“EITF”) <br />and/or the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”).
